Description
Purpose of the Position/ Role Summary
The HR Business Partner (HRBP) supports business leaders by providing practical, commercially aware HR advice and guidance. The role focuses on strengthening manager capability, supporting employee relations, and enabling effective performance management, while ensuring consistency with company policies and local employment legislation.
The HRBP operates as a key link between the HR function and the business, balancing hands-on operational support with forward-looking people planning.
This is a 2 year fixed term contract
Key Role Specific Requirements
Business Partnership & Manager Support
· Build strong working relationships with managers and act as a trusted point of contact for HR matters
· Provide day-to-day guidance on people management, performance, and team effectiveness
· Support managers in making fair, consistent, and compliant decisions
Performance Management
· Support the delivery of the performance management cycle (goal setting, mid-year reviews, annual reviews)
· Guide managers on performance improvement planning and managing underperformance
· Encourage a consistent and high-quality approach to performance conversations
Workforce Planning & Organisational Support
· Partner with managers to understand team structures, capability gaps, and hiring needs
· Provide input into headcount planning and role design
· Support organisational changes, ensuring smooth implementation and communication
Employee Relations
Lead on employee relations cases, including disciplinary, grievance, and investigation processes
Provide clear, practical advice aligned with local employment law and company policy
Coach managers on handling sensitive or complex employee issues
Recruitment & Talent
· Support recruitment activity through workforce planning and manager guidance
· Partner with hiring managers to ensure effective selection decisions
· Contribute to onboarding and retention initiatives within the business area
HR Policies & Compliance
· Ensure consistent application of HR policies and procedures
· Provide guidance on policy interpretation in line with local legislation
· Support compliance requirements across jurisdictions (contracts, processes, documentation)
Data & Insights
· Monitor key HR metrics (e.g. turnover, absence, performance outcomes)
· Identify trends and highlight risks to managers and HR leadership
· Support action planning based on insights (e.g. engagement survey outcomes)
Change & Continuous Improvement
· Support business-led change initiatives (e.g. restructures, process improvements)
· Contribute to improving HR processes and ways of working
· Promote a positive employee experience through practical HR support
Experience
· Strong working knowledge of employment law (multi-country experience desirable)
· Experience supporting employee relations cases end-to-end
· Ability to build credible relationships with managers
· Practical, solution-focused approach to HR challenges
· Strong communication and interpersonal skills
· Experience working in a fast-paced, operational environment
· Minimum 5 years’ experience within the HR function
· Relevant Bachelor’s Degree
Key Behaviours
· Pragmatic and commercially aware
· Confident in advising and challenging where appropriate
· Calm and balanced when handling sensitive issues
· Collaborative and supportive approach
· Focused on consistency and fairness
About Bimeda
Bimeda is a leading global innovator, manufacturer and marketer of veterinary pharmaceuticals and animal health products and has over half a century’s experience in providing science-driven solutions to optimize the health, wellbeing and productivity of the world’s animals.
Bimeda’s global innovation program sees six state-of-the art R&D centers across four continents collaborate on an enviable product development pipeline which anticipates the ever-evolving needs of the animal health industry.
Bimeda’s nine manufacturing facilities across seven countries allow the company to manufacture a broad range of preventative, curative and nutritional products including sterile injectables, vaccinations, nutritional boluses, feed additives, tablets, water-soluble powders, pastes and non-sterile liquids.
Globally, the company focuses on the development, manufacture and commercialization of quality Bimeda-branded products while also being the partner of choice for contract manufacturing and R&D services for prominent companies within the animal health industry.
